"""
QUANTITY CONVENTION:
All quantity fields in this application represent GRAMS.
- Food.serving_size: base serving size in grams (e.g., 100.0)
- Food nutrition values: per serving_size grams
- MealFood.quantity: grams of this food in the meal (e.g., 150.0)
- TrackedMealFood.quantity: grams of this food as tracked (e.g., 200.0)
To calculate nutrition: multiplier = quantity / serving_size
"""
